Output ff95fc5d2f5ea0045a9a1bd1f7af7340e2fae1713d4b03cc66b785fee5c20fa0:0

value
1654112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 def8268963651188e87d04260431d35737071c15 OP_EQUAL
address
3N1yCvyicpHj48ayMsfvhB2zptfbErGaM8
transaction
ff95fc5d2f5ea0045a9a1bd1f7af7340e2fae1713d4b03cc66b785fee5c20fa0
confirmations
170860
spent
true